INTERROLL, Booth 915These conveyor rollers reduce litho ink buildup and provide maintenance-free operation in packaging operations. In printed pasteboard packaging applications, such as beverage and food, among others, the rollers resist the buildup of lithographic ink, glue and carton dust that typically plague materials handling operations as printed cartons are conveyed from packaging machines to the palletizer.
